It is great - it's good to see that the government is finally being more of a leader on political issues instead of the usual 'stay-the-course' management we've seen a lot of recently. All we need is the Senate to rubber stamp it and it's good to go.

It's interesting to notice how the country hasn't been sucked into the social chaos Mr. Harper alluded to. Although it's a fairly recent event nationally, in Nova Scotia we've had it for months now, but still there have been no riots on the streets, families spontaneously breaking up, etc.
